Shelving has many uses. The main ones are:
- Context Switching: Saving the work on your current task so you can switch to another high priority task. Say you're working on a new feature, minding your own business, when your boss runs in and says "Ahhh! Bug Bug Bug!" and you have to drop your current changes on the feature and go fix the bug. You can shelve your work on the feature, fix the bug, then come back and unshelve to work on your changes later.
- Sharing Changesets: If you want to share a changeset of code without checking it in, you can make it easy for others to access by shelving it. This could be used when you are passing an incomplete task to someone else (poor soul) or if you have some sort of testing code you would never EVER check in that someone else needed to run. h/t to the other responses about using this for reviews, it is a very good idea.
- Saving your progress: While you're working on a complex feature, you may find yourself at a 'good point' where you would like to save your progress. This is an ideal time to shelve your code. Say you are hacking up some CSS / HTML to fix rendering bugs. Usually you bang on it, iterating every possible kludge you can think up until it looks right. However, once it looks right you may want to try and go back in to cleanup your markup so that someone else may be able to understand what you did before you check it in. In this case, you can shelve the code when everything renders right, then you are free to go and refactor your markup, knowing that if you accidentally break it again, you can always go back and get your changeset.

Here's what you should do:
- Open the Visual Studio Command Prompt. This will give you a command line window with the PATH set to run VS / TFS tools
Download the Work Item Type definition that you want to modify (e.g. Bug, Task):
witadmin exportwitd /collection:collectionurl /p:project /n:typename [/f:filename]
This will give you the WIT's definition, in XML format.
- Open the XML file. You will edit the rules for the Assigned To field. Find the term "System.AssignedTo"
- In the Allowed Values rule element, modify (or add if none exists) your List Item element to limit the values to members of one (or more) TFS / Active Directory group(s). Your field definition should look like this:
<FIELD name="Assigned To" refname="System.AssignedTo" type="String" syncnamechanges="true" reportable="dimension">
<HELPTEXT>The person currently working on this bug</HELPTEXT>
<ALLOWEXISTINGVALUE />
<ALLOWEDVALUES expanditems="true" filteritems="excludegroups">
<!-- Below is a TFS group. Note you actually type "[project]" verbatim -->
<LISTITEM value="[project]\Contributors" />
<!-- Below is an AD group. The name and group are examples only -->
<LISTITEM value="MYDOMAIN\Developers" />
</ALLOWEDVALUES>
</FIELD>
Importing your changes:
- Save your file.
- In the command line window type the following:
witadmin importwitd /collection:collectionurl /p:project /f:filename
That's it. Your work item type is now limited to the people you want.

The web services are not documented by Microsoft as it is not an officially supported route to talk to TFS. The officially supported route is to use their .NET API.
In the case of your sort of application, the course of action I usually recommend is to create your own web service shim that lives on the TFS server (or another server) and uses their API to talk to the server but allows you to present the data in a nice way to your application.
Their object model simplifies the interactions a great deal (depending on what you want to do) and so it actually means less code over-all - but better tested and testable code and also you can work around things such as the NTLM auth used by the TFS web services.
